What organ do we use to breathe?
(Answer: Lungs)
What energy source powers a flashlight?
(Answer: Batteries)
What are the three main types of rocks?
(Answer: Igneous, sedimentary, metamorphic)
What is the effect of gravity?
(Answer: It pulls objects toward the Earth)
What is littering?
(Answer: Throwing garbage carelessly in the environment)
What do we call animals that eat both plants and animals?
(Answer: Omnivores)
What type of energy does the sun provide?
(Answer: Solar energy)
What do we call the path the Earth takes around the sun?
(Answer: Orbit)
What simple machine is used in a ramp?
(Answer: Inclined plane)
Why is clean water important?
(Answer: For drinking, hygiene, and health)
Which system in the body controls movement and senses?
(Answer: Nervous system)
Which device converts electrical energy to sound?
(Answer: Speaker or radio)
What causes the seasons on Earth?
(Answer: The tilt of the Earth’s axis and its orbit around the sun)
How can friction be reduced?
(Answer: By using lubricants or smoother surfaces)
What are renewable resources?
(Answer: Natural resources that can be replaced, like wind and sunlight)
What is the function of the roots in a plant?
(Answer: To absorb water and nutrients, and anchor the plant)
What happens in a closed electrical circuit?
(Answer: Electricity flows and powers devices like bulbs)
Which planet is known as the "Red Planet"?
(Answer: Mars)
What is the purpose of a wheel and axle?
(Answer: To make movement easier by reducing friction)
Name one natural disaster that affects Jamaica.
(Answer: Hurricane, earthquake, flood)
How do amphibians differ from reptiles?
(Answer: Amphibians live part of their lives in water and part on land, while reptiles live on land and have scales)
What is an insulator?
(Answer: A material that does not allow electricity to pass through easily, e.g. rubber)
What is erosion?
(Answer: The wearing away of land by wind, water, or other forces)
Why is a screwdriver considered a simple machine?
(Answer: It is a type of lever or inclined plane that makes work easier)
What is composting and why is it good for the environment?
(Answer: It's recycling food and plant waste into fertilizer; reduces waste and enriches soil)
